Headline: This Day in History: Hurricane Katrina Slams Into Gulf Coast

Caption: August 29, 2005. The Category 4 hurricane became the worst natural disaster in U.S. history. The city of New Orleans bore the brunt. 145 mph winds turned cars into projectiles and overwhelmed poorly tended levees that protected the city, located six feet below sea level.
